General William Gamble

General William Gamble and staff

 

Here for your browsing pleasure is an imposing photo of District of Columbia. General William Gamble and staff at Camp Stoneman, the cavalry depot at Giesborough Point. It was made in 1865.

The illustration documents Washington, 1862-1865, view of the defenses of Washington.
